    "Who Are The Seattle Kraken?"

    By Glenn Dreyfuss,

    2024-02-14

    Great minds ponder great questions, such as "How high is 'up?'" and "Do fish get thirsty?" and "Why do we cook bacon and bake cookies?"

    And this season, great hockey minds are pondering, "Who are the Seattle Kraken?" On his podcast , Jeff Marek and guest Greg Wyshynski took a stab at answering.

    Greg Wyshynski: "If you had asked me what the Seattle Kraken were a month ago, I would have said, 'A team counting its lottery odds.' Now, they're right back in it. If they get in as a wild card team, it's hard to say how you approach the future after that, because that's two playoff qualifications in a row."

    Jeff Marek: "They really confuse me. You see a lot of different versions of teams throughout a year. I don't know which Seattle Kraken is the real version. At times they've looked like a traditional expansion team. Then when they went on that rip not too long ago, they looked like a 'Vegas' style expansion team."

    GW: "The numbers tell you they should be a better offensive team and a worse defensive team. Part of the reason they seem so 'Jekyll and Hyde' is that they regress to what they should be, and other times they're above what they're expected to do."

    JM: "Which is the real Matt Beniers? The one we saw last year with the Calder Trophy? Or the one we see struggling, seeing minutes reduced, seeing assignments reduced, going all the way down from the penthouse to the first floor?"

    JM: "They're loaded with prospects. The future does look bright for the Seattle Kraken. They've really drafted well. Do they do something different? As wild as making a trade for Tomas Hertl? And maybe you don't re-sign Alex Wennberg."

    Well, that cleared up absolutely nothing. Then again, maybe this is one of those unanswerable questions which the Hockey Gods pose to drive us insane.

    Marek is absolutely right, though, that the biggest complicating factor in figuring out the Kraken is last season's unexpected success. "You've done it once. Now your fans expect it every single year."
